Cadence EDA工具手册:原理图与PCB设计流程

需积分: 48 250 下载量 94 浏览量 更新于2024-08-06 收藏 14.95MB PDF 举报
"《创建原理图的流程-深入PCI与PCIe:硬件篇和软件篇》是关于使用Cadence Allegro进行EDA设计的手册,涵盖了从原理图设计到PCB设计,再到高速仿真的全过程。手册特别强调了Cadence Allegro SPB 15.2版本的使用,为新进员工提供了基础教程,帮助他们快速掌握Cadence工具的基本操作。" 在创建原理图的流程中,首先需要理解Cadence Allegro这个强大的EDA工具。Cadence Allegro是一款广泛应用于电子设计自动化领域的软件,特别适合进行复杂的电路板设计。在创建原理图的过程中,有以下几个关键步骤: 1. **启动项目管理器**:开始设计前,首先要通过项目管理器来组织和管理设计的各个部分,这包括设置项目属性,导入必要的库元件,以及管理设计的不同版本。 2. **库管理**:Cadence提供了丰富的库资源,包括原理图库、PCB库和仿真库。在设计过程中,需要根据设计需求选择或创建合适的元件符号和模型。原理图库包含电路元器件的图形表示,PCB库则包含实际PCB制造所需的物理元件信息,而仿真库则包含了用于验证电路性能的模型。 3. **原理图输入**:使用Cadence Allegro的DesignHDL模块,设计师可以绘制电路原理图,连接各个元器件,定义电路的工作原理。在这个阶段,设计师需要确保每个元件的引脚正确连接,并且符合设计规范。 4. **设计转换和修改管理**:完成原理图后,需要将设计转换为PCB布局的格式,这一过程通常涉及网表的生成。同时,设计过程中可能需要反复修改,因此有效的设计管理和版本控制至关重要。 5. **物理设计与加工数据的生成**:在PCB设计阶段,设计师会在Allegro的PCBDesign环境中进行布局和布线,考虑电气规则、物理约束以及高速设计原则。最终,会生成制造所需的数据,如Gerber文件,供PCB制造商使用。 6. **高速PCB规划设计环境**:在设计高速PCB时,需要考虑信号完整性、电源完整性等问题,Cadence提供PCBSI和SigXplorer等工具进行高速仿真实验,确保设计在实际运行中能够达到预期性能。 7. **约束管理器**:在原理图和PCB设计中,约束管理器用来设定和管理设计的电气和物理约束,如时序、阻抗匹配等,确保设计满足性能要求。 8. **自动布线器**:使用PCBRouter,设计师可以自动化地完成布线工作,优化走线路径,减少电磁干扰,提高设计效率。 《EDA工具手册》旨在提供一个全面的 Cadence 使用指南,从基础知识到高级技巧,帮助用户熟练掌握Cadence Allegro,从而有效地进行PCI和PCIe等相关硬件设计。通过学习和实践,设计人员可以深入了解硬件设计的流程,从概念到实物,确保设计的准确性和可靠性。